Ajou University President Dong Yeon Kim gave a special lecture to 30 Suwon City officials who are participating in the Key Leaders Education Program. The Suwon Municipal Government commissioned the University's Graduate School of Public Affairs to operate the Program.


During the lecture held on the afternoon of November 28th under the theme 'Game-changing Revolution,' President Kim discussed his experiences as a public official and related anecdotes, emphasizing the two major changes facing Korean society, their implications, and how we should address them.


He said, "We are facing the Fourth Industrial Revolution and the outrage of a majority of the people in our society due to structural social problems."


He went on to say, "The Fourth Industrial Revolution requires us to foster creative and flexible talents above all," adding, "Polarization and social inequality should be properly addressed for our society to develop in a sustainable manner."


He concluded his lecture by saying, "After you finish this program, I ask that each of you always consider how you can contribute to dealing with social issues and return to your work as government officials with this in mind."


Thirty officials from the Suwon Municipal Government are attending the Key Leaders Education Program, which lasts for ten months. The Program includes 19 subjects including “The Changing Administrative Environment and Local Government Administration for the Future,” “Proper Views of Public Positions,” “Laws and Regulations Relevant to Municipal Officials,” and “Education on Informatization.” This year marks the second year of the education program.
